Calk AI 1.0
Calk AI
Platform to build custom AI agents from internal docs and tool integrations like Notion, Slack, and Intercom.
Key features
- Instant Connectors: Prebuilt integrations to popular workplace tools (Notion, Slack, Intercom and more) so agents can immediately access documents, messages, and customer data without lengthy setup.
- No-Code Agent Builder: Create and configure custom AI agents quickly without node-based workflows or heavy engineering, enabling non-technical teams to deploy agents in seconds.
- Knowledge Ingestion: Indexes and trains agents on internal docs and company data to provide contextual, business-specific answers and recommendations.
- Actionable Integrations: Agents can not only retrieve information but interact with connected tools and workflows to perform tasks or surface insights within existing systems.
- Rapid Deployment: Redesigned app focused on speed and scalability to launch multiple agents for different teams or functions across an organization.
- Agent-Oriented UX: Interfaces and tooling designed to manage, test, and iterate on agents that represent specialized 'AI co‑workers' for business use.

jcode
1jehuang
Open-source, resource-efficient coding agent harness built for multi-session workflows, deep customizability, and high performance.
Key features
- Multi-Session Workflows: Purpose-built to run many concurrent coding-agent sessions on a single machine without resource contention.
- Ultra-Low RAM Footprint: ~28 MB baseline for a single session with local embeddings off — several times leaner than comparable harnesses.
- Cross-Platform: First-class support for Linux, macOS, and Windows via GitHub Releases with Homebrew and source builds.
- Infinite Customizability: Harness internals are exposed for deep tweaking — providers, prompts, memory, and tooling can all be swapped.
- Provider-Agnostic: Configure your own LLM providers rather than being locked into one vendor.
- Benchmarks Included: Public benchmark suite at jcode.sh/bench so users can compare RAM, boot-up, and session performance against alternatives.
- Local Embedding Toggle: Turn local embedding on for retrieval-heavy work or off to minimize resource usage.
- Community Support: Active Discord community and dedicated docs site for onboarding and customization help.
Best for
- Running Ten Agents in Parallel: A developer spins up a coding agent per repo and lets them work in parallel without exhausting RAM.
- Low-Resource Machines: Use jcode on older laptops or cloud VMs where heavier harnesses eat too much memory to be practical.
- Custom Harness for a Specific Stack: Deeply customize prompts, tools, and providers to match a language or company codebase.
- Benchmark-Driven Selection: Teams evaluating agent harnesses use jcode's published metrics to compare performance apples-to-apples.
- Self-Hosted Coding Agents: Bring your own LLM provider (local or cloud) to avoid vendor lock-in on a proprietary harness.
